2020 American Community Survey (ACS), 5-year estimates - ACS is an ongoing survey administered by the US Census Bureau which provides information on people, economy, housing, and more. This interface maps some of the most in-demand variables for Connecticut towns.

Connecticut Zoning Atlas - The Connecticut Zoning Atlas is a first-in-the-nation interactive map showing how an entire state zones for housing.

Housing and affordability - Data on housing and affordability for each of Connecticut's 169 towns and cities.

Hurricane Sandy Flooding - A NYTimes survey of the flooding in NY & NJ after hurricane Sandy, October 30, 2012.

Town profiles - Two-page reports of demographic and economic information for Connecticut towns.
